Strategic Design Leadership Roles
At the pinnacle of compensation are design leadership positions that blend creative vision with business acumen. Chief Design Officers and VP of Design sit at the executive table, aligning design strategy with corporate objectives. These roles require not only mastery of design principles but also the ability to build scalable design systems, manage multi-disciplinary teams, and quantify design’s ROI through metrics like conversion rate optimization and customer satisfaction scores.
Design Director and Head of Design
Design Directors and Heads of Design act as the bridge between C-suite strategy and execution. They curate team talent, define the design process, and ensure that every product decision reflects the brand’s strategic goals. Their compensation is heavily weighted toward performance bonuses and equity, given their direct influence on product-market fit and the success of major launches.

Industry and Geographic Premiums
Earnings in design vary significantly based on industry vertical and location. Tech hubs like San Francisco, New York, and Seattle offer the highest base salaries, often supplemented by robust equity packages. Financial services, healthcare, and enterprise B2B sectors frequently outbid consumer brands for top design talent, recognizing the direct link between thoughtful design and regulatory compliance, risk mitigation, and customer trust.
